Bike Lane Rules
Wilmington's bicycle code, City Code § 5-36, requires cyclists on a roadway or bikeway to ride as near the right side as practicable and in single file except where riding two abreast is allowed. Motor vehicles may not travel or park within a bikeway when it would conflict with a bicyclist's use, and every violation is a punishable infraction.
